Getting There

  • Car

    To reach the Fortress in Sestola from Garfagnana by car, start by heading south on the SS12 road. Follow the signs towards Modena. After approximately 35 kilometers, take the exit towards Sestola. Continue on the SP324 for about 10 kilometers until you arrive at Sestola. The Fortress is located at Via Rocca, 2. You can park in the nearby public parking areas, which may incur a small fee (around €1-3 per hour).

  • Public Transportation

    If you prefer public transportation, take a train from Garfagnana to Modena. Trains run regularly, and the journey takes about 1.5 hours. From Modena, transfer to a bus heading to Sestola; the bus ride will take around 40 minutes. Upon arriving in Sestola, walk or take a short taxi ride to Via Rocca, 2. Be sure to check the bus and train schedules in advance, as they may vary, and tickets typically cost between €5-10.

  • Taxi

    If you prefer a more direct option, you can hire a taxi from your location in Garfagnana. The drive to Fortress in Sestola will take approximately 40 minutes, depending on traffic. Be prepared for a fare that may range between €50-70 for the one-way trip.

Discover more about Fortress

Perched atop a hill overlooking the charming town of Sestola, the Fortress is a remarkable testament to medieval architecture and history. This stunning castle dates back to the 10th century and has served various purposes over the years, from a defensive stronghold to a residence for nobility. As you approach the fortress, you'll be greeted by its impressive stone walls and towering battlements, which provide a fascinating glimpse into the past. The views from the ramparts are nothing short of spectacular, offering panoramic vistas of the surrounding mountains and lush valleys. It's a perfect spot for photography enthusiasts and those looking to soak in the natural beauty of the region. Inside the fortress, visitors can explore well-preserved chambers that tell the story of its rich history. Guided tours are available, providing insights into the castle's strategic importance and the lives of the people who once inhabited it. The surrounding area is equally enchanting, with hiking trails that wind through the scenic landscape, making it a delightful destination for outdoor enthusiasts.
